> We are currently working on an E4 application which must include a 
> Preferences page. We have seen that the EPreferences project has been 
> developed to provide an API for managing the preferences but it seems that no 
> existing project aims at managing the graphical part. 
> 
> We would like to integrate the Eclipse community and contribute to the 
> Eclipse e4 project by developing a generic Preferences page, similar to the 
> Eclipse 3.x one. If it isn't possible, we will have to develop our own 
> graphical page, which could be moved if a standard one is developed in the 
> future. Our main idea is to base on the EPreferences project and to extend 
> the EMF model to provide a Preferences object which could be use by any 
> application.
